The Landesmuseum Mainz is delighted to present the first solo museum exhibition of the artist Moritz Koch in August 2025. Entitled MEMORIESOF ANOTHER TOMORROW, the exhibition brings together the NOTES FROM FUTURE, FORGOTTEN PATH and NIGHTMARE IN PARADISE series to create an impressive overall show. NOTES FROM FUTURE and FORGOTTEN PATH, which are currently still in production, will be presented to the public for the first time.
Moritz Koch has made a name for himself throughout Germany with his elaborate, conceptual, scenic photographs. His works are reminiscent of film stills and are created in large-scale productions in which up to 200 extras and 30 historic vehicles are part of the staging. This visual abundance is complemented by precise lighting direction and a narrative visual language. Wrapped in a retro-futuristic aesthetic, Koch's motifs reflect current social issues in the field of tension between past, present and future.
The exhibition invites visitors to an extraordinary art experience that allows them to fully immerse themselves in Moritz Koch's visual worlds. In addition, unique 360-degree VR artworks can be explored that question the boundaries between reality and fiction. Insights behind the scenes of the complex production processes round off the exhibition.
The special exhibition is a cooperation project between the state capital Mainz and the General Directorate for Cultural Heritage Rhineland-Palatinate, Landesmuseum Mainz.
